HOW TO Build a fully integrated aquarium filter. Its like having a sump, without needing and overflow, plumbing or an extra aquarium below your tank.

@Plan-C 9 лет назад
Hi. Great videos. Learned a bunch. Thanks. FYI. I just built a couple of temperature regulator boxes. These are failsafes and prevent overheat failure of the (usually cheap) internal thermostats in aquarium heaters which tend to fail in the 'on' position. They can also turn on fans/off lights if temp gets too high. Used the STC100 which is dirt cheap ($6-15), a water resistant junction box ($5) and some old flex and sockets. Just an idea if you want to look into it. They are a/c so usual cautions apply. All the best.

@SlimTim_dirty_aquatics 9 лет назад
I've always wanted to build filter like this but worried about on losing space in the aquarium. Plan getting 75 gallon in which become 55 with this filter in it. Never cease to amaze me, Fired Up!!!
@thekingofdiy
@thekingofdiy 9 лет назад
A 3" wide side wall filter would only take 5 gallons on a 75 gal. A 3" wide back wall would leave 62 gallons.

@JungleScene
@JungleScene 9 лет назад
***** but really, those gallons are only lost in show space, not water volume... you can still stock the tank like a 75, right?
@SlimTim_dirty_aquatics
@SlimTim_dirty_aquatics 9 лет назад
The Graceful Savage good question. *****
@thekingofdiy
@thekingofdiy 9 лет назад
You can account for the water volume but stock according to surface area. If the opposite were the case, that would mean that you could keep an Oscar in a 10 gal tank as long as you have a 90 gal sump.. Which simply isn't the case. Water volume helps with dilution, but space is what you stock by.
